LNG Carrier Containment Market Overview

LNG Carrier Containment Market (USD Million)

LNG Carrier Containment Market was valued at USD 14,658.49 million in the year 2024.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 20,352.53 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.8%.

The LNG Carrier Containment Market is essential for maintaining safety and efficiency in the storage and transport of liquefied natural gas. With LNG gaining momentum as a cleaner alternative to traditional fuels, containment systems have become vital for handling extremely low temperatures. More than 65% of LNG carriers now rely on advanced containment solutions, underlining their importance in modern maritime energy transport.

Key Growth Factors
The market is propelled by the rising adoption of LNG as a transitional fuel across industries. Membrane-based containment systems have recorded over 40% growth in adoption, largely because of their space optimization and operational reliability. Environmental compliance pressures are also accelerating the shift toward solutions that reduce boil-off rates and enhance cargo security.

Technological Innovations
Innovation is at the core of this industry, with nearly 30% of newly built LNG carriers featuring advanced insulation and double-barrier containment structures. These upgrades help minimize energy losses, extend vessel durability, and lower long-term operational costs. As marine fuel costs continue to rise, such technological integration is becoming increasingly indispensable.

Challenges in the Market
High costs associated with installation and ongoing maintenance present notable hurdles. Approximately 25% of total operating expenses of LNG carriers stem from containment system upkeep. The technical challenges of maintaining cryogenic conditions further limit entry for smaller players, compelling established companies to intensify their focus on research and development.
